Best car insurance quotes for drivers with high-risk vehicles in Oklahoma

Finding the best car insurance quotes for drivers with high-risk vehicles in Oklahoma can be a daunting task. High-risk vehicles often include sports cars, luxury vehicles, and older models that may not have modern safety features. These are generally considered more prone to accidents or theft, resulting in higher insurance premiums. However, knowing where to look and what factors to consider can significantly slash your premiums.

One of the first steps in obtaining the best car insurance quotes is to understand the types of coverage available. In Oklahoma, drivers are required to have liability insurance, but many choose to add comprehensive and collision coverage for better protection. It’s important to weigh the costs against the potential benefits, especially when driving a high-risk vehicle.

To find competitive insurance quotes, consider using online comparison tools. Websites that specialize in comparing car insurance rates can provide a wealth of information in a matter of minutes. By entering basic details about yourself and your vehicle, you can tailor your search to find the best coverage options at the most affordable prices. Be sure to compare at least three to five different providers to get a comprehensive view of your options.

Insurance companies often look at various factors when determining premiums for high-risk vehicles. Your driving record, age, and even credit history can influence your rate. Maintaining a clean driving record is pivotal. Safe driving courses can also potentially lower your premiums, showing insurers that you are committed to responsible driving.

Another way to secure better rates is by considering usage-based insurance programs. Many insurers now offer devices that track your driving habits, including speed, braking patterns, and mileage. If you are a safe driver, this could lead to significant savings over time. In Oklahoma, some companies provide discounts for low-mileage drivers, which is beneficial for individuals who don’t drive their high-risk vehicles frequently.

Additionally, many insurers offer discounts for bundling policies. If you already have homeowners or renters insurance, consider purchasing your auto insurance from the same provider. This could lead to substantial savings. Furthermore, asking about any available discounts—such as good student discounts or military discounts—can also be beneficial.

Your choice of deductible plays a crucial role in your premium costs. Opting for a higher deductible can lower your monthly payments but be ready to pay more out of pocket in case of a claim. Assess your financial situation and choose a deductible that balances savings and affordability in the event of an accident.

Finally, it’s essential to regularly review your auto insurance coverage. As vehicle prices fluctuate and as you make changes in your life, your insurance needs may change as well. Reassessing your policy at least once a year can help you secure better rates and ensure you have adequate coverage for your high-risk vehicle.
